Easy hiking trails in Winston County, Alabama, traverse a landscape dominated by the Bankhead National Forest and the Sipsey Wilderness. This region features dense forests, sandstone cliffs, and numerous creeks, often leading to waterfalls. The terrain includes varied elevations and unique geological formations, such as the Natural Bridge.

July 19, 2023, Caney Creek Falls

While technically not in the Sipsey Wilderness, the short hike to the nearby Caney Creek Falls is worth a stop on a visit to this area. The falls are considered by many to be one the the most scenic in Alabama. They are about 20 feet high and run off into a shallow pool. During times of greater flow another set of falls flows to the right of the main one.

Are there any easy trails with waterfalls in Winston County?

Yes, Winston County, particularly within the Sipsey Wilderness, is known as the "Land of 1000 Waterfalls." You can find easy trails leading to beautiful cascades. For example, the Caney Creek Falls Hiking Trail is an easy 2.7 km route to a stunning waterfall. Another option is the short Shangri-La Falls Trail, which is just over 1 km long.

What kind of terrain can I expect on easy hikes in Winston County?

Easy hikes in Winston County generally feature gentle slopes and well-maintained paths. You'll often find yourself walking through dense forests, alongside creeks, and sometimes over sandstone formations. While most trails are relatively flat, some may have minor elevation changes, like the Sipsey Big Tree trail with about 24 meters of ascent over 7 km.

Are there any easy loop trails in Winston County?

Yes, for those who prefer circular routes, the Natural Bridge Park Loop is an excellent easy option. This trail is just over 1 km and takes you around the impressive Natural Bridge formation, offering a complete scenic experience.

What are the best easy trails for families with children?

Many easy trails in Winston County are perfect for families. The Natural Bridge Park Loop is a short, engaging walk around a unique geological feature. The Shangri-La Falls Trail is also very short and leads to a waterfall, making it exciting for younger hikers. These trails offer manageable distances and interesting sights to keep everyone entertained.

Are easy hiking trails in Winston County dog-friendly?

Most trails within the Bankhead National Forest and Sipsey Wilderness are dog-friendly, provided your dog is kept on a leash. Always check specific park regulations before you go. Trails like the Sipsey Big Tree trail offer plenty of space for you and your leashed companion to enjoy the natural surroundings.

What is the best time of year to enjoy easy hikes in Winston County?

Spring and fall are generally the best times for easy hikes in Winston County. In spring, you'll witness abundant wildflowers and lush greenery, including rare Alabama Azaleas. Fall offers spectacular foliage. Summers can be warm and humid, while winters are mild, making year-round hiking possible, though some trails might be muddier after rain.

Are there any unique natural landmarks to see on easy hikes?

Absolutely! The most prominent natural landmark is the Natural Bridge, located in Natural Bridge Park. It's a 148-foot sandstone bridge, the longest natural bridge east of the Rocky Mountains. The Natural Bridge Park Loop trail takes you directly to this impressive formation. The park also features a cave-like bluff and a rock outcropping resembling a Native American head.
